GCC Compiler setup problem: "Cannot exec `as': No such file or directory"
AngleWyrm:
Hi,
Just tried installing MingW and a Nightly (D:/Prog/Mingw, D:/Prog/CodeBlocks). I've deleted the old Release Candidate and I'm guessing some path info is missing/wrong.
When I try to compile a project, I get an error message from mingw32-g++ that reads:
"Cannot exec `as': No such file or directory."
What is this `as', and where do I go to point the right path?
AngleWyrm:
Ok, figured it out; But I've left this post and answer in case anyone else has this problem.
as.exe is the MingW assembler program, and is included in the binutils distribution. I just had to download and extract that in my MingW directory, and now it works.

For future references...
Those who want to use MinGW on windows plattforms for C/C++ development, should download and unzip all the related packages into the same folder ("C:\mingw", for instance). The current stable commonly needed official packages are:
gcc-core-3.4.2-20040916-1.tar.gz
gcc-g++-3.4.2-20040916-1.tar.gz
mingw-runtime-3.9.tar.gz
mingw-utils-0.3.tar.gz
w32api-3.6.tar.gz
binutils-2.15.91-20040904-1.tar.gz
mingw32-make-3.80.0-3.tar.gz
gdb-6.3-2.exe (beware that gdb current version in MinGW site is 5.2.1-1)
And don't forget to add <MINGW>\bin to your PATH (replacing <MINGW> with the folder where you unzipped the files, e.g.: C:\mingw or simmilar). That's all.
